DIN EN 3718

Aerospace series - Test method for metallic materials - Ultrasonic inspection of tubes; German and English version EN 3718:2012

scope:

This European Standard specifies the requirements for ultrasonic inspection of tubes in metallic materials with an external diameter ≥ 5 mm.

For other cases, the use of this standard is by agreement between the manufacturer and the purchaser.

The purpose of the ultrasonic inspection is the detection of defects within the wall thickness and at the outer and inner surfaces of the tube. The method will detect two dimensional defects in the longitudinal and circumferential directions perpendicular to the tube wall. Where inspection for other types of defects is required, this requirements should be stated on the order.
